Hey plugin folks — quick heads up from the Hooksmith team. Starting next release, failed webhook deliveries retry with exponential backoff, max five attempts, then we park the event for 24 hours. Make your handlers idempotent, since duplicates are possible during retries. Full docs coming Friday. The rollout build token is below.

session token of tajef-bageg = htk21_5d90d574934f3ccae6437

Subject: DR drill Thursday — deep-link routing cutover

Rena,

Thursday's disaster-recovery drill exercises mobile deep-link routing on Larkspun. We fail the primary resolver, confirm links fall back to the Veldt mirror, and measure time-to-route. Your part: freeze the release train at 08:30, tag the candidate build, and hold store submissions until the all-clear. Rollback scripts are staged; do not edit them mid-drill. If the mirror vault prompts during failback, enter the recovery passphrase printed below.

strongbox words: aldax-istox-sorion-isteth-gilion-tamius-norok-aldax-fraox-wenius

## Clock skew on build agents

Quick note for review: the Pellwick build fleet syncs against our internal time source every boot, but agents that hibernate can drift a few seconds. Provenance checks tolerate ±30s; anything beyond that fails the attestation step automatically. If you need to verify a specific run, use the token printed just below.

trace token, kawip-fafog: htk14_26e64c4d35154e

Action item: The Relayn deploy-status bot silently dropped updates when the pipeline API paginated results, so responders believed a rollback had completed when it had not. We will add pagination handling, a staleness banner, and an integration test. Until merged, verify deploy state directly in the pipeline console, documented at the page below.

runbook for kahop-kajop: https://rundeck.ordinio.test/display/secrets/pipeline/issue/pages/repo/browse/e5732776e07d1285107e5aeb